Direct Connection

A Zero-Hop Connection forms a instantaneous link between two nodes. This avoids the need for any routers, enabling efficient data transmission. Zero-Hop Connection is particularly valuable in situations where delay is critical.

Unplugged

In today's world, the concept of being off-grid is becoming more and more relevant. It means intentionally stepping away from the constant surge of technology and recharging with the real world.

Quite a few people find that being unplugged allows them to be more present. It can help reduce stress. Ultimately, embracing unplug is about taking control in a world that often feels fast-paced.
